The Myth and the Reality

The Grotta di Polifemo is intrinsically linked to the epic tale of Odysseus (Ulysses) and the one-eyed giant Polyphemus from Homer's Odyssey. According to legend, Polyphemus, son of Poseidon, lived in a cave and trapped Odysseus and his men, intending to eat them. Odysseus famously blinded the cyclops with a sharpened stake and escaped by clinging to the bellies of sheep. While the Milazzo location is a dramatic natural sea cave evoking this myth, the Grotta di Sperlonga offers a more tangible connection. This grotto was part of Emperor Tiberius's lavish seaside villa and featured elaborate sculptures depicting scenes from the Odyssey, including the blinding of Polyphemus. These sculptures, now housed in the National Archaeological Museum of Sperlonga, provide a fascinating glimpse into how the myth was celebrated and integrated into Roman life. Instagram+1

Exploring these sites allows visitors to connect with ancient stories and the history of the regions. The dramatic coastal setting of the Milazzo cave enhances the sense of adventure and myth, while the archaeological discoveries in Sperlonga offer a deeper understanding of Roman culture and their fascination with Greek mythology. It's a journey that bridges the gap between legend and history, making the visit both educational and enchanting. Instagram

The Sperlonga Grotto: An Imperial Retreat

The Grotta di Polifemo in Sperlonga is not just a natural cave but a significant archaeological site, once part of Emperor Tiberius's sprawling seaside villa. This grotto was ingeniously adapted to serve as a triclinium, or dining hall, where guests could dine while gazing at elaborate sculptures depicting scenes from the Odyssey. The most famous of these sculptures illustrate the blinding of Polyphemus, a testament to the Romans' appreciation for Greek mythology and their desire to integrate it into their luxurious lifestyles. Instagram

Excavations have revealed a complex of interconnected grottos and pools, showcasing the architectural ingenuity and artistic sophistication of the Roman era. The site offers a unique opportunity to walk through history, imagining the banquets and conversations that once took place within these ancient walls. The nearby National Archaeological Museum of Sperlonga houses the recovered sculptures, providing essential context and a deeper appreciation for the grotto's original splendor. Instagram
